Public Law 81-740, passed by Congress in _____, granted FFA a federal charter.

Public Law 81-740 granted the Future Farmers of America (FFA) a federal charter in 1950, formally recognizing the importance of FFA in agricultural education.

Public Law 81-740, passed by Congress in 1950, granted the Future Farmers of America (FFA) a federal charter. This law officially recognized the role of FFA in agricultural education and allowed it to function as a federally chartered intracurricular student organization. A federal charter for a youth organization indicates formal recognition by the United States government and ensures ongoing federal support.
